What Are Gate Valves?

Gate valves are straight-seated, linear-motion valves intended for opening or stopping the flow of a liquid or a gaseous medium. The methods often employed include a gate or wedge that opens, which can rise or drop in operation with the aim of controlling the flow.  These valve features are usually used in situations that call for unobstructed passage of fluids through the valve with little or no resistance.

What Are Ball Valves?

On the other hand, the ball or isolating valves employ a round ball that contains a channel at its core. When the ball is rotated 90 degrees, the hole is either in the flow path/open or is in the opposite direction/close. This makes the ball valves easy to operate, as they are very simple mechanisms to use.

Frequently Asked Questions About Gate Valves vs. Ball Valves

Which Valve Lasts Longer?

Ball valves are usually more reliable in their characteristics due to their simple structure and relatively fewer numbers of their elements. It remains well-sealed even after a relatively long period of time when it is not in use.

Can Gate Valves Be Used to Regulate Flow?

Gate valves cannot be used for throttling or regulating the flow of the fluid either directly or indirectly. They make havoc where they are used in partially opened positions in the long run.

Which Valve Is More Suitable for Emergency Shut-Off?

Ball valves are better to use when the shut-off valve is required for an emergency because it can operate with its help in a quarter turn.
